Cost difference

VBIL is 9 bps cheaper than TBIL. On a $100,000 position that's about $90/yr more in fees for TBIL.

Holdings overlap is the sum of min(weight_a, weight_b) over positions matched on ISIN (CUSIP fallback). Methodology: see/methodology/.
